Drugs raid in Hailsham leads to arrests

Three people were arrested following a drugs raid in Hailsham.

Sussex Police said officers swooped on a property in Archery Walk on Tuesday, June 9, and found and seized cocaine with an approximate street value of £3,000 and around £200 in cash.

A spokesman said: “Three people have been arrested and a quantity of cocaine seized after police executed a drugs warrant in Hailsham.

“Three people - a 54-year-old woman, a 26-year-old woman and a 24-year-old man – were arrested on suspicion of being concerned in the supply of a Class A drug.

“All three have been released under investigation while enquiries continue.”

Wealden Prevention Inspector Jon Gross added: “This enforcement activity demonstrates our ongoing commitment to tackle drugs harm in our Sussex communities.

“These arrests will hopefully provide some reassurance within the local neighbourhood where this was occurring.”
